In the old part of Bukhara, tourists narrowly escaped injury due to the negligence of an illegal balloon seller. Footage shared on social media shows people sitting at tables in a cafe as a cluster of balloons flies past them, suddenly igniting and exploding. The cafe visitors managed to run to safety.
According to the regional police press service, the incident occurred in the historic part of the city. A large number of gas-filled balloons rose into the air and came into contact with a power line, causing a short circuit. The balloons then burst into flames and exploded.
An investigation revealed that the balloons were sold by a 19-year-old citizen. He purchased ordinary balloons at the market and filled them with household natural gas at a friend's private home.
Administrative protocols were drawn up against the seller and the homeowner. Residents are urged to be cautious when buying balloons from street vendors and to remember that experimenting with gas endangers the lives and health of others.
